Olde Dobbin Station will provide a unique experience for its clients through the use of old structures built in the early 1900’s, restored to their original look and feel, while adding a vintage touch. The buildings were initially used by oil companies as a “pumping station” and later became a famous place of fellowship for those in the community due to its Artesian Water Well. It became the community “swimming hole” according to many of the locals and remains a historical marker for the community and its residents. Olde Dobbin has recently renovated its final structure and officially has made it into a chapel. The “chapel” was initially used in the late 1800’s as a pump house for the nearby trains' steam.

What's the Average Cost of Wedding Venues in Texas?

Wedding venues in Texas typically cost between $3,000 and $30,000+ depending on what you're looking for. The national average runs about $6,500-$12,000 which represents roughly 25% of your total wedding budget. Your overall wedding costs will depend largely on how many people you're inviting to share your special day:

Guest CountAverage Total Wedding Budget
50 guests$19,410
100 guests$32,365
150 guests$44,545
200 guests$55,433
250 guests$66,322
300 guests$77,211
In Texas specifically, venues typically account for about 16% of your total wedding budget with couples spending an average of $6,932. This gives you plenty of room in your budget to customize other elements of your celebration that matter most to you and your partner.

How Far in Advance Should You Book Your Texas Venue?

Texas couples typically book their wedding venues about 16 months (or 457 days) before their wedding date. November stands out as the most popular month for venue inquiries so planning early is essential if you're considering this timeframe. This advanced booking timeline helps you secure your preferred date since popular venues often fill their calendars far in advance especially for prime weekend dates. Booking early also allows you to lock in current pricing before annual increases that many venues implement. Plus you'll have more time to work with venue coordinators to customize floor plans and discuss details that will make your celebration uniquely yours.

What Wedding Expenses Should You Budget for in Texas?

Beyond your venue there are several other key expenses to consider when planning a Texas wedding. For a typical 150-guest celebration your budget will likely break down this way: - Florists: $6,755 (15%) - Venue: $6,932 (16%) - Catering: $5,546 (12%) - Bar services: $4,437 (10%) - Photographers: $3,966 (9%) - Videographers: $3,555 (8%) - Planners: $3,768 (8%) - Bands & DJs: $1,299 (3%) - Cakes & desserts: $853 (2%) - Hair & makeup: $495 (1%)
